· Marlin Art Auction: Patti Aldridge mentioned that she had been involved with a fundraiser that proved to be quite easy, and profitable. Tickets are pre-sold, the art company comes in and sets up their collection of art work, which is extensive and diverse. People attend the function, light snacks are provided and then an Auctioneer holds a good old fashion Auction and the pieces are bid on. The company takes Credit Cards and Checks and handles all of the money they send the organization a check for over 50% of the proceeds. The concern was if it conflicted with the fine arts department’s fundraiser.
